Technology and the Philippine Food Supply Chain
Across Southeast Asia, digital platforms have accelerated the pace at which food moves along the supply chain. In the Philippines, this means inventory visibility for vendors, predictive forecasting for fishermen and farmers, and faster, more transparent delivery networks for urban households. The core question is not whether technology can coordinate deliveries, but how it integrates with local markets, geographic realities, and cultural preferences. Huawei-UK, as a player in the broader digital ecosystem, points to a model where high speed connectivity, cloud-based data services, and intelligent logistics converge to reduce spoilage, improve price discovery, and expand access to new food channels without erasing regional specialties.
On the demand side, consumers increasingly combine online menus, neighborhood micro-delivery, and cashless payments. This converges with supply chain improvements to support a wider variety of foods at predictable quality and price points. Yet the Philippines presents unique challenges: dispersed islands, variable electricity and transport infrastructure, and price volatility driven by weather, harvest cycles, and global markets. A practical approach is to view technology as a cooperative tool—one that helps smallholders and local vendors integrate with larger networks while retaining the trust and familiarity that define Filipino food culture.
From a business perspective, the logic of digital logistics rests on modular, scalable capabilities. Real-time tracking, cold chain monitoring, and AI-assisted demand planning can reduce waste and shrink delivery times. In markets where small traders comprise the backbone of the food economy, platform-enabled finance and digital payments can unlock working capital, enabling restocking and inventory turnover that previously hinged on cash flow cycles. The broader implication is a shift from episodic, episodic restocking toward continuous optimization, which benefits consumers with steadier product availability and better pricing signals.
Policy, Data, and Small Businesses in the Philippines
Policy frameworks shape how digital logistics operate, especially when food safety, consumer protection, and cross-border commerce intersect. For small food businesses and wet-market vendors, data access and digital literacy are as important as hardware and software. Governments can facilitate this transition by supporting standardized data formats, affordable access to connectivity, and user-friendly training that lowers the barrier to entry for local vendors. This is not about replacing local practices but about embedding them within resilient digital workflows that improve traceability, reduce spoilage, and protect vulnerable livelihoods.
Privacy and security concerns accompany any move toward more data-driven commerce. In the Philippines, policymakers must balance rapid digital adoption with safeguards against data misuse and cyber risks. A practical governance approach emphasizes local control over data, clear consent models for vendors and consumers, and transparent rules for platform interoperability. The aim is to create a level playing field where traditional stall holders and modern online sellers compete on value and reliability rather than access to capital or networks alone. Beyond policy, there is a social dimension to technology adoption. Community organizations, cooperatives, and educational institutions can play a critical role in ensuring that digital tools translate into tangible improvements for cooks, fishers, and farmers. When community voices guide implementation, new logistics capabilities become extensions of local culture rather than external impositions. This fosters trust, which is essential for sustained adoption in a country as diverse as the Philippines.
